So, How Long Should You Burn a Candle?

The safest answer is to follow the burn-time instructions provided with your specific candle.

Different candles can vary based on their wax blend, wick, vessel size and fragrance formulation.

For that reason, there isn't one universal burn time that applies perfectly to every candle.

However, there are several general candle-care principles worth following.


Avoid Extremely Short Burns

If you repeatedly light your candle for only a few minutes, the wax may not have enough time to melt evenly across the surface.

Over time, this can contribute to an uneven melt pattern or tunneling.

Instead, when you decide to light your candle, give it enough time to develop a reasonably even melt pool without exceeding the recommended burn time.


Avoid Excessively Long Burns

It's also important not to assume that longer burns are better.

Once a candle has been burning for an extended period, the container and wax can become very hot.

That's why it's important to follow the manufacturer's instructions and extinguish the candle within the recommended timeframe.


Watch the Flame

Your candle flame can tell you a lot.

A flame that is unusually large, smoking or flickering excessively may indicate that the wick needs attention or that the candle is being affected by a draft.

Allow the candle to cool completely before trimming the wick.


Trim the Wick Between Burns

Before your next burn, trim the cooled wick to approximately ¼ inch, unless the manufacturer's instructions specify otherwise.

This simple habit is one of the most important parts of routine candle care.


Never Leave a Burning Candle Unattended

This is one candle-care rule that should never be skipped.

If you leave the room, extinguish your candle.

Don't leave a burning candle unattended or burning while you sleep.


The Best Candle Routine

A simple routine can make candle care effortless:

Before burning: Trim the cooled wick.

During burning: Keep the candle on a stable surface away from drafts and anything flammable.

After burning: Extinguish the candle and allow it to cool completely before moving it.

Before storing: Make sure the candle is completely cool and free of debris.
